The Netopen Natural Fancy Orange-Yellow Raw Diamond Rough Crystal Specimen at 1.3 carats presents a color combination that occupies the boundary between the more common yellow and the significantly rarer orange color categories in the natural diamond spectrum — the orange-yellow that results from a specific combination of nitrogen-related N3 defect centers and additional structural features that modify the pure yellow color into a more complex orange-influenced tone that moves the specimen towards the fancy orange-yellow classification used in the international diamond color grading system. The addition of orange influence to yellow in natural diamonds is not simply a matter of more nitrogen — it requires specific additional structural characteristics that are statistically less common than the pure nitrogen-yellow mechanism, which explains why orange-yellow and orange diamonds command premium pricing over comparable size and clarity yellow diamonds in both the faceted and rough markets.
